A bike camp exclusively for Women

A four-day camp designed to help women build skills, confidence, and community in the bike park. Includes skills sessions, park laps, and small-group coaching. Riders will progress at their own pace in a supportive, encouraging environment led by experienced female coaches. Focus areas include cornering, braking control, body positioning, and navigating technical features with confidence. Whether you’re looking to level up your riding or connect with other women who love the bike park, this camp is all about building skills—and having a lot of fun doing it.

Required Equipment:

  • Full Suspension Mountain Bike
    A full suspension mountain bike is required. Your bike should be suitable for lift-accessed trail riding, with functioning brakes, reliable shifting, and properly set suspension.
  • Full-Face Helmet
    A certified full-face mountain biking helmet is mandatory to provide maximum protection on technical descents and trail features.
  • RECOMMENDED: Protective Gear
    • Knee Pads
    • Gloves
    • Elbow Pads
    • Chest/Back Protection .
  • Hydration System
    Bring a water bottle (in a cage) or a hydration backpack to stay hydrated throughout the session.
  • Appropriate Clothing
    Dress in moisture-wicking, weather-appropriate layers. Bring a light jacket for cooler evening temps. MTB-specific apparel is ideal for durability and comfort.
